Background: Despite the Coronary Artery Reporting and Data System (CAD-RADS) providing a standardized approach, radiologists continue to favor free-text reports. This preference creates significant challenges for data extraction and analysis in longitudinal studies, potentially limiting large-scale research and quality assessment initiatives.

Objective: To evaluate the ability of the generative pre-trained transformer (GPT)-4o model to convert real-world coronary computed tomography angiography (CCTA) free-text reports into structured data and automatically identify CAD-RADS categories and P categories.

Importance: Consumer wearable technologies have wide applications, including some that have US Food and Drug Administration clearance for health-related notifications. While wearable technologies may have premarket testing, validation, and safety evaluation as part of a regulatory authorization process, information on their postmarket use remains limited. The Stanford Center for Digital Health organized 2 pan-stakeholder think tank meetings to develop an organizing concept for empirical research on the postmarket evaluation of consumer-facing wearables.
